mongodb,聚合查詢命令格式:db.COLLECTION_NAME.aggregate(AGGREGATE_OPERATION)示例:db.COLLECTION_NAME.aggregate( [ { "$match" : { "status" : { "$ne ...
mongodb,聚合查詢命令格式:db.COLLECTION_NAME.aggregate(AGGREGATE_OPERATION)示例:db.COLLECTION_NAME.aggregate( [ { "$match" : { "status" : { "$ne ...
MongoDB二個主要的操作:一個是查詢,另一個是統計。對於查詢而言,主要是find()方法,再配合Filters組合多個查詢條件。 對於統計而言,則主要是aggregate操作,比如 group、sum、avg、project、match…… aggregate可以將上述操作組織 ...
假定有一列實體類對像 List<User> list = UserServer.getList(); 去重,去除重復對象(每個屬性的值都一樣的),需要注意的是要先重寫對象Us ...
先下載個C#的驅動。MongoDB提供各種主流與非主流預言的開發驅動。 C# Driver 下載地址:這里 CSharp Driver Tutorial:這里 下載文件安裝或者解壓縮包 如果您是安裝,請到安裝位置尋找,如果是ZIP壓縮包,解壓縮包得到如下兩個文件 ...
@Override public MessageDto getCheckInMembersByFlight(String fltDt, String fltNr, String channe ...
最近在檢索MongoDB的數據時需要用到分組操作,由於沒有現成的說明文檔可參考,只能是在代碼中不斷調試、摸索前進;目前已現實了Java對MongoDB的分組操作,並統計各個分組的數量。現通過示例詳細解析,步驟如下流程所示: (1)測試環境條件准備:MongoDB的版本為2.0.1,如下圖所示 ...
分組獲取數據: db.express_info.group({ "key":{"express_code":true}, "initial":{"num":"0","mobile":"0"}, "reduce":function(doc,result){result.num++ ...